IP查询
查询
你查询的IP:[119.128.195.208] 地理位置:中国–广东–东莞
最新查询
118.248.165.198
122.200.128.243
119.128.173.107
116.196.248.118
202.164.172.100
119.232.249.165
202.100.176.209
222.128.170.139
120.141.189.207
119.128.195.208
202.112.126.153
117.75.117.81
121.16.253.246
123.178.9.183
117.59.140.198
202.153.48.173
220.232.64.135
122.119.122.50
122.200.64.6
202.173.8.181
116.58.208.84
202.93.252.93
203.223.28.177
202.180.128.181
218.192.185.191
116.213.64.200
123.112.43.103
202.136.48.123
119.123.53.192
203.176.168.51
202.38.152.254